chromium/out/Default/gen/ui/webui/resources/cr_components/certificate_manager/certificate_manager_v2.mojom-params-data.h

// ui/webui/resources/cr_components/certificate_manager/certificate_manager_v2.mojom-params-data.h is auto generated by mojom_bindings_generator.py, do not edit

// Copyright 2019 The Chromium Authors
// Use of this source code is governed by a BSD-style license that can be
// found in the LICENSE file.

#ifndef UI_WEBUI_RESOURCES_CR_COMPONENTS_CERTIFICATE_MANAGER_CERTIFICATE_MANAGER_V2_MOJOM_PARAMS_DATA_H_
#define UI_WEBUI_RESOURCES_CR_COMPONENTS_CERTIFICATE_MANAGER_CERTIFICATE_MANAGER_V2_MOJOM_PARAMS_DATA_H_

#include "mojo/public/cpp/bindings/lib/bindings_internal.h"
#include "mojo/public/cpp/bindings/lib/buffer.h"

#if defined(__clang__)
#pragma clang diagnostic push
#pragma clang diagnostic ignored "-Wunused-private-field"
#endif

namespace mojo::internal {
class ValidationContext;
}


namespace certificate_manager_v2::mojom {
namespace internal {
class  CertificateManagerPageHandlerFactory_CreateCertificateManagerPageHandler_Params_Data {};
static_assert;
class  CertificateManagerPageHandler_GetCertificates_Params_Data {};
static_assert;
class  CertificateManagerPageHandler_GetCertificates_ResponseParams_Data {};
static_assert;
class  CertificateManagerPageHandler_GetCertManagementMetadata_Params_Data {};
static_assert;
class  CertificateManagerPageHandler_GetCertManagementMetadata_ResponseParams_Data {};
static_assert;
class  CertificateManagerPageHandler_ViewCertificate_Params_Data {};
static_assert;
class  CertificateManagerPageHandler_ExportCertificates_Params_Data {};
static_assert;
class  CertificateManagerPageHandler_ImportCertificate_Params_Data {};
static_assert;
class  CertificateManagerPageHandler_ImportCertificate_ResponseParams_Data {};
static_assert;
class  CertificateManagerPage_AskForImportPassword_Params_Data {};
static_assert;
class  CertificateManagerPage_AskForImportPassword_ResponseParams_Data {};
static_assert;

}  // namespace internal


class CertificateManagerPageHandlerFactory_CreateCertificateManagerPageHandler_ParamsDataView {};


class CertificateManagerPageHandler_GetCertificates_ParamsDataView {};


class CertificateManagerPageHandler_GetCertificates_ResponseParamsDataView {};


class CertificateManagerPageHandler_GetCertManagementMetadata_ParamsDataView {};


class CertificateManagerPageHandler_GetCertManagementMetadata_ResponseParamsDataView {};


class CertificateManagerPageHandler_ViewCertificate_ParamsDataView {};


class CertificateManagerPageHandler_ExportCertificates_ParamsDataView {};


class CertificateManagerPageHandler_ImportCertificate_ParamsDataView {};


class CertificateManagerPageHandler_ImportCertificate_ResponseParamsDataView {};


class CertificateManagerPage_AskForImportPassword_ParamsDataView {};


class CertificateManagerPage_AskForImportPassword_ResponseParamsDataView {};





inline void CertificateManagerPageHandler_GetCertificates_ResponseParamsDataView::GetCertsDataView(
    mojo::ArrayDataView<SummaryCertInfoDataView>* output) {}




inline void CertificateManagerPageHandler_GetCertManagementMetadata_ResponseParamsDataView::GetMetadataDataView(
    CertManagementMetadataDataView* output) {}


inline void CertificateManagerPageHandler_ViewCertificate_ParamsDataView::GetSha256HashHexDataView(
    mojo::StringDataView* output) {}






inline void CertificateManagerPageHandler_ImportCertificate_ResponseParamsDataView::GetResultDataView(
    ImportResultDataView* output) {}




inline void CertificateManagerPage_AskForImportPassword_ResponseParamsDataView::GetPasswordDataView(
    mojo::StringDataView* output) {}



}  // certificate_manager_v2::mojom

#if defined(__clang__)
#pragma clang diagnostic pop
#endif

#endif  // UI_WEBUI_RESOURCES_CR_COMPONENTS_CERTIFICATE_MANAGER_CERTIFICATE_MANAGER_V2_MOJOM_PARAMS_DATA_H_